But in early 2014,    Dropbox updated its app to use the HTTPS (Hypertext Transfer    Protocol Secure) communications protocol, helping it bypass the    country's censorship.  <\/p>\n<p>    China, however, has begun cutting access to Dropbox's HTTPS    address, banning the company's services completely in what    GreatFire.org said was the \"strictest method of blocking.\"  <\/p>\n<p>    Dropbox did not immediately respond to a request for comment.    The Dropbox site was inaccessible from Beijing, and the    company's apps failed to synch data between devices.  <\/p>\n<p>    China has been stepping up its censorship lately, targeting    Google on May 31 with a block that's disrupted access to nearly    all the company's services. The government has given no    explanation for the move, but it took place just ahead of the    25th anniversary of the Tiananmen Square pro-democracy protests    that were brutally quashed on June 4, 1989.  <\/p>\n<p>    The historical event is among the many censored topics in the    country; before it was blocked, Google was one source of    unfiltered search results about it.  <\/p>\n<p>    Prior to the Google block, terrorists in China's western    Xinjiang region also killed dozens in a bombing attack. The    country's state-run media later reported that Chinese police    had arrested several terrorist groups that had been using    messaging apps and online videos to organize.  <\/p>\n<p>    In the case of Dropbox, the service's blocking will probably    affect few users. China's own Internet giants including Baidu    are offering similar cloud storage services and Dropbox has yet    to actively market its services to the country.  <\/p>\n<p>    In recent weeks, Chinese Internet users have been complaining    about the country's Google blocking, and have urged the    government to end it. Government censors, however, are deleting    social-networking posts about the topic, according to    GreatFire.org.
